Optimizing Filtration with Hydrophilic PES Membranes
PES membranes offer a significant advantage in filtration processes, particularly when dealing with aqueous solutions. Their inherent hydrophilic nature, achieved through careful modification techniques, reduces biofouling and improves flux. This enhanced wetting characteristic allows for greater throughput and consistent performance compared to less hydrophilic alternatives. Selecting the appropriate pore size and membrane material remains critical for effective particle removal and overall system efficiency.
